/**
* @param str_ip 字符串类型的ip
* @param port 端口
* @param file1 要发送的文件
*/
public void send(String str_ip, int port, File file1)
{
try {
//字符串转化成ip地址
InetAddress ip = InetAddress.getByName(str_ip);
//获取文件
File file = new File(file1.toString());
try {
// 将文件名发送过去
String str_filename = file.getName();
String str_tip = "有文件,请处理:" + str_filename;
/*
* 先把数据转化成字节
* Datagrampacker 第一个参数是数据 第二个参数是数据长度 第三个数据是ip 第四个数据是端口
*/
byte[] fileNameBuf = str_tip.getBytes();
DatagramSocket socket = new DatagramSocket();
DatagramPacket packet = new DatagramPacket(fileNameBuf, fileNameBuf.length, ip, port);
socket.send(packet);
socket.close();
FileInputStream fis = new FileInputStream(file);// 从文件中取出写入内存
// 将文件长度发送过去
int fileLen = fis.available();
String str_len = "" + fileLen;
byte[] fileLenBuf = str_len.getBytes();
socket = new DatagramSocket();
packet = new DatagramPacket(fileLenBuf, fileLenBuf.length, ip, port + 1);
socket.send(packet);
socket.close();
// 发送文件主体
byte[] buf = new byte[1024];
int numofBlock = fileLen / buf.length;// 循环次数(将该文件分成了多少块)
int lastSize = fileLen % buf.length;// 最后一点点零头的字节数
socket = new DatagramSocket();
for (int i = 0; i < numofBlock; i++) {
fis.read(buf, 0, buf.length);// 写入内存
packet = new DatagramPacket(buf, buf.length, ip, port + 1);
socket.send(packet);
Thread.sleep(1); // 简单的防止丢包现象
}
// 发送最后一点点零头
fis.read(buf, 0, lastSize);
packet = new DatagramPacket(buf, buf.length, ip, port + 1);
socket.send(packet);
Thread.sleep(1); // 简单的防止丢包现象
//
fis.close();
socket.close();
//
System.out.println("文件传输完毕!");
//
} catch (Exception ev) {
System.out.println(ev);
}
} catch (Exception ex) {
ex.printStackTrace();
}
}
